Concert poster
vintage concert poster for The Turtles and Oxford Circle, advertising a show at the Fillmore Auditorium in San Francisco on Wednesday, July 6, 1966. The poster is a well-known piece of psychedelic art from the era, known as "BG-15" in the Bill Graham poster series.
Poster Details
Bands: The Turtles (known for hits like "It Ain't Me, Babe" and "Happy Together") and the Oxford Circle.
Venue: Fillmore Auditorium in San Francisco, CA.
Date: Wednesday, July 6, 1966.
Promoter: Bill Graham Presents in Dance-Concert.
Artists: The poster was designed by the pioneering psychedelic artist Wes Wilson, who incorporated whimsical drawings of turtles playing instruments by German caricaturist Heinrich Kley.
Style: The poster is characteristic of the mid-1960s San Francisco music scene, featuring fluid, distorted lettering and vibrant colors. |
